Output e86d51eb5a0fba9440ee76ffecf5ff4b2f1eac478c9faf61dcb4a958df7dac30:0

value
10262
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67b7de09f89e4fe589250fc78fbb26a367d5c2d66e0bd2e519e55e0b872610ee
address
bc1pv7mauz0cne87tzf9plrclwex5dnatskkdc9a9egeu40qhpexzrhqglwqu0
transaction
e86d51eb5a0fba9440ee76ffecf5ff4b2f1eac478c9faf61dcb4a958df7dac30
spent
true